MB: Funktional oder Klassenbasierend bei Konfiguration & Initialisierung im PHP Framework?

Beitrag lesen

moin dedlfix,

ich hab pl so verstanden das man von innen nach ausen entwickeln sollte.

Du gehst von dem aus, was letztlich verwendet werden soll. Zumindest bei der Planung.

exakt.

Wenn da zwei oder mehr Klassen sind, die ähnliches tun, dann kann daraus eine Basisklasse entstehen.

Das werde ich später tun. Darauf möchte ich sehr gern zurück greifen!

Das war es dann aber auch schon mit der Hierarchie an dieser Stelle. Es wird am Ende kein großes Gebilde entstehen

ist ja auch nicht Mein Sinn der Sache.

Stattdessen werden eher viele kleine Hierarchien entstehen, wenn überhaupt die Notwendigkeit der Auslagerung in Basisklassen besteht. Wenn du das Prinzip der Trennung nach Zuständigkeiten berücksichtigst, arbeiten die Teile deines Frameworks relativ autonom und sind nicht auf Erbschaften angewiesen. Wenn sie mit anderen zusammenarbeiten, dann in Form der Übergabe als Parameter.

So auch meim Gedanke. Danke für die Bestärtigung :).

vlg MB